Stafford Pharmacy & Home Healthcare is an independent pharmacy embracing the expanded scope of practice for community pharmacists in Alberta. We also provide compounding services for both human and veterinary patients. We are a destination for home healthcare products with a registered nurse and home healthcare consultants on staff.

We are currently seeking our next team member: Clinical Pharmacist.

Your clinical community pharmacist duties will include but are not limited to:

  1. Working collaboratively with patients’ physicians and other healthcare professionals to ensure positive drug therapy outcomes
  2. Conducting health screening
  3. Engaging in community outreach programs
  4. Conducting in-pharmacy immunization clinics
  5. Performing medication reviews and patient care plans as per the provincial standards
  6. Applying the full scope of practice as a clinical pharmacist in Alberta
  7. Patient counseling on the selection and use of non-prescription medication
  8. Administering vaccinations and medications for injection – subcutaneous, intramuscular
  9. Ensuring accurate pharmacotherapy
  10. Supervising and consulting with registered technicians compounding prescribed pharmaceutical products for both human and veterinary patients
  11. Advising patients and healthcare professionals on medication indications, contraindications, adverse effects, drug interactions, and dosages
  12. Maintaining medication profiles of patients, including discussions, follow-ups, and communication with other healthcare practitioners
  13. Supervising the proper preparation, packaging, distribution, and storage of vaccines, serums, biologicals, and other pharmaceuticals
